### CI note: EXIF scrubber flaking on HEIC fixtures

Heads up, future maintainers — the Pellgrove EXIF scrubbing step occasionally fails on the HEIC test fixtures because the container pulls a newer codec that reorders metadata boxes. The scrubber then misses the GPS block and the assertion trips. Pin the codec package in the CI image and the job goes green. The last known-good image corresponds to the token below.

trace token, fafog-kageg: htk4_98e6

Subject: Orvane launch — final plan

Branch managers,

Orvane ships on the 14th. Stock arrives at all branches by the 9th. Window displays go up the 11th, no earlier. Pricing is locked; no local discounts. Staff training packs land Monday — complete them before launch day. Escalate supply gaps to Petra Lindqvist immediately. Before you brief your teams, note the following:

board note of bajop-yaweg: The western region missed its Pelys quota by 58.0 percent last quarter. Pelysek Foods plans to raise the Belius list price by 44.0 percent in July. The steering committee signed off on a budget of $133.8 million for Project Pelax. The renewal with Zoraelix Systems closes at $61.9 million a year, 12.7 percent above the last contract.

CI note for future maintainers: the PointsPerch loyalty-ledger job keeps flaking on the nightly run because the ledger replay step races the fixture seeding. Quick fix that works: bump the seed timeout to 90s and rerun — don't just retry the whole pipeline, you'll waste twenty minutes. If it still fails, check the ledger checksum stage first. I've pinned the last known-good run; its token is right below.

build token for yajof-bajof: htk31_506ff1188f74596b5bb2eec94edc43c

Facilities Ticket — Cleaning Crew Access, Brindle Annex

For new starters handling evening lock-up: the Sorano Cleaning crew arrives nightly at 21:30 via the annex side door. Check their rota sheet, note arrival in the log, and ensure the storeroom is relocked afterward. To let them through the side door, enter the access code below.

badge for yaweg-hafog: bdg-GX-6

## Runbook: Restarting the Ashgrove Audit-Log Viewer

If the viewer shows stale entries, first confirm the ingest worker is current before restarting anything — restarting mid-ingest can drop a batch. Drain the worker, wait for the queue depth to reach zero, then cycle the viewer pods one at a time. Record each restart in the shift log, and note the build token shown below.

session token of kageg-tahop = htk14_af3c1ccccb7dcf